Output 043a42c75c136c964c72a384242d52fee9be2fcdf9b796454e701d57d346a7c4:1

value
18316876825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0392a0006fc96a66e3129f58b808e41ec9308d70 OP_EQUAL
address
321uboYb6n7Yeo5UzesFgvHhurCwsRFQJG
transaction
043a42c75c136c964c72a384242d52fee9be2fcdf9b796454e701d57d346a7c4
spent
true